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 4 and 6 is 12
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 12 - For the 1st fraction, since 4 × 3 = 12,
12/4 = 12 × 3/4 × 3 = 36/12 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 6 × 2 = 12,
40/6 = 40 × 2/6 × 2 = 80/12 - Add the two like fractions:
36/12 + 80/12 = 36 + 80/12 = 116/12 - 116/12 simplified gives 29/3
- So, 12/4 + 40/6 = 29/3
